- The distance between Dubai, United Arab Emirates and Storlien, Sweden is approximately 5,267 km or 3,273 mi.
- To reach Dubai in this distance one would set out from Storlien bearing 122.7°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Dubai bearing 155.3° or SSE .
- Dubai has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Storlien has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
- Dubai is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Storlien is in or near the subpolar rain tundra biome.
- The annual average temperature is 25.7 °C (46.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.3 °C (7.7°F) less in Dubai.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 908.2 mm (35.8 in) less which is equivalent to 908.2 l/m² (22.29 US gal/ft²) or 9,082,000 l/ha (970,926 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 37.9° higher in Dubai than in Storlien.
- Relative humidity levels are 24.4%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 19.5°C (35.2°F) higher.
